ELD Mandate
The ELD (Electronic Logging Device) Mandate in the USA requires electronic devices to be always
connected to the telematics vehicle. Since the Micronet SmartCAM™ is a portable device and all
telematics information is stored on the device, the is equipped with an LED and Buzzer to alert when
the device not docked while the vehicle’s ignition switch is ON. This LED and Buzzer WARN the driver
and reminds him or her to dock the device in the cradle.
Fix Mount Lock
The Micronet SmartCAM™ has a locking mechanism option to permanently install the device and
prevent tampering. It is an option when a fix mount installation is required. The fix mount lock parts
include one screw to prevent pushing the latch and an adhesive cover to hide the screw.
LED and Buzzer
The LED and buzzer are used to alert the driver that the Micronet SmartCAM™ is not locked in place.
This alert is enabled by default. The cradle’s MCU firmware provides an API to disable both the LED and
buzzer if required.
